Technical SEO covers whether search engines can actually crawl, render, and index your site correctly, and whether the experience it delivers meets Google’s performance bar. Great content on a technically broken site often never gets the chance to rank at all.

Crawlability and Indexing

Before anything else can matter, Google has to be able to find, crawl, and index your pages. Check your robots.txt is not accidentally blocking important sections, confirm important pages are not set to noindex by mistake, and submit a current XML sitemap through Google Search Console. This sounds basic, and it is, but it remains one of the most common issues we find in audits: a security plugin or migration leaves a block in place that nobody notices for months.

Core Web Vitals Explained

Google measures three specific performance metrics as part of its page experience signals. Largest Contentful Paint measures how fast the main content of a page loads, targeting under 2.5 seconds. Interaction to Next Paint measures how quickly the page responds to a click or tap, targeting under 200 milliseconds. Cumulative Layout Shift measures how much a page visually jumps around while loading, for example a button shifting right as an ad loads above it, targeting under 0.1. Pages that fail these thresholds can still rank, but they are working against themselves, and on competitive terms that gap can decide the outcome.

Image weight and unoptimized third party scripts are the two most common causes of a failing Core Web Vitals score.

Mobile Friendliness

Google indexes the mobile version of your site first, not the desktop version, which means a page that looks great on a laptop but breaks or hides content on a phone is being evaluated on the broken version. Test your key pages directly on a phone, not just in a browser’s responsive mode, since real devices surface issues simulators miss.

Site Architecture and Sitemaps

A clean, shallow site structure, where any page is reachable within a few clicks from the homepage, helps both crawlers and users. An accurate, current XML sitemap gives search engines a direct map of what exists and how recently it changed, which matters even more for large sites where crawl budget is limited.

HTTPS and Security

HTTPS has been a baseline ranking signal for years now, and it is table stakes for user trust regardless of any SEO impact. Beyond the certificate itself, keep your CMS, plugins, and themes updated, since a compromised site can get flagged by Google’s safe browsing systems and disappear from results entirely until it is cleaned up and reviewed.

How to Run a Quick Technical SEO Audit

A real technical audit can run for days on a large, complex site, but most small and mid sized businesses can get a genuinely useful first pass in under an hour. 1
Run Google PageSpeed Insights on your homepage and two or three key inner pages. Look at all four scores, Performance, Accessibility, Best Practices, and SEO, not just the headline number. 2
Check Google Search Console’s Coverage report. Confirm the pages you actually want indexed are indexed, and investigate anything listed as excluded or blocked that shouldn’t be.

3
Open your robots.txt directly in a browser. Confirm it isn’t accidentally disallowing sections of the site that should be crawlable.

4
Test your key pages on an actual phone. Not a browser’s responsive mode. Real devices surface layout and tap-target issues simulators regularly miss.

5
Run Google’s Rich Results Test on a few key pages. Confirm any structured data is actually present and free of errors, not just assumed to be working.

Common Technical SEO Mistakes

The most common mistake is treating a technical audit as a one time launch task instead of an ongoing check. A plugin update, a theme change, or a migration can silently reintroduce a blocked robots.txt or a broken sitemap months after everything was working correctly. A second common mistake is optimizing Largest Contentful Paint in isolation while ignoring Interaction to Next Paint and Cumulative Layout Shift, since a page can load its main content quickly and still feel broken if it jumps around or lags on the first tap. A third is assuming a fast homepage means a fast site, when the pages that actually matter for a given campaign, a service page or a location page, were never tested individually. A fourth, and often the most expensive to unwind, is layering content and design work on top of a technically unhealthy foundation for months before anyone runs a real audit.

FAQ

What are Core Web Vitals?
Three specific performance metrics Google uses to measure page experience: Largest Contentful Paint, Interaction to Next Paint, and Cumulative Layout Shift, targeting under 2.5 seconds, under 200 milliseconds, and under 0.1 respectively.

Does site speed actually affect rankings?
Yes, both directly as a page experience signal and indirectly, since slow pages have higher bounce rates, which correlates with weaker rankings over time.

How do I check if Google can crawl my site properly?
Google Search Console’s coverage report and URL inspection tool are the most reliable free ways to see exactly how Google is crawling and indexing your pages.

Is HTTPS really necessary?
Yes. It has been a baseline ranking signal for years, and browsers now actively warn visitors away from non HTTPS sites, which hurts trust regardless of any SEO impact.

How often should a technical SEO audit be repeated?
At minimum after any major change, a redesign, a migration, a new plugin, or a hosting switch, plus a periodic check every few months even without a known change, since issues like a silently blocked robots.txt can appear without any obvious trigger.

Does a fast homepage mean the rest of my site is fast too?
Not necessarily. Individual pages can carry different image weights, scripts, or embeds. It’s worth testing the specific pages that matter most for a given campaign or ranking goal, not just the homepage.
